So, we finally got up to Tracie's new place--really nice! She made us fantastic flammkuchen, a speciality from the Alsace--the region of France on the German border near Karlsruhe. It's basically a pizza, but made with crème fraîche or sour cream instead of tomato sauce. Mmmm, yummy! I'll need to find a good recipe for when we move to Australia!
